The video tutorial walks through solutions to an AP Physics C electricity and magnetism problem. It covers the setup of charged spheres, drawing free body diagrams, analyzing forces, and solving for unknown charges. The tutorial also explores the effects of replacing a non-conducting sphere with a conducting one, using Gauss's law to find the electric field around a charged tube, and calculating the electric force and work done on a sphere.
